    The Prixic System is a set of genders that are described as being completely separate from the binary. Unlike various other gender systems, they are not man or woman aligned, and are instead their own axis of genders, similar to proxvir and juxera.

    The genders currently under the Prixic System are as follows:

    • Etolic: A fully independent masculine gender that is not connected to binary manhood at all, nor is it on the same axis as binary men. May also be completely separate from binary masculinity in some cases. Similar to proxvir. May be comparable to man-related for some, but this is not inherent.
    • Privere: A fully independent feminine gender that is not connected to binary womanhood at all, nor is it on the same axis as binary women. May also be completely separate from binary femininity in some cases. Similar to juxera. May be comparable to woman-related for some, but this is not inherent.
    • Lumian: A fully independent neutral gender that is not connected to any binary alignment, nor is it on the same axis. May also be completely separate from other neutral terms (like neutrois) in some cases.
    • Mazeric: Multigender. This can include fluid, bigender, trigender, polygender, pangender, and any other form of being multigender. This usually describes those who are multigender with prixic genders.
    • Intrisic: Genderless. May still have a deep connection to the Prixic System, but is ultimately completely without gender. May still be etolic, privere, lumian, etc. aligned.
    • Wispic: A xenic gender. May have specific xenogenders that the user aligns with, or may be a xenic gender that is completely separate from known xenogenders and xenic identity.


    Other than this, the Prixic System also has combined labels, which may fall under mazeric:

    • Evoire - Etolic/Privere.
    • Etolian - Etolic/Lumian.
    • Espic - Etolic/Wispic.
    • Privian - Privere/Lumian.
    • Prispic - Privere/Wispic.
    • Wispian - Lumian/Wispic.
    • Wimolic - Etolic, wispic, and lumian.
    • Primolic - Privere, wispic, and lumian.

    Etymology

    The creator of the Prixic System has stated that no label used in the system has a traceable origin or meaning. This is so that anyone can identify with one of the labels due to it's originality, as well as the words being made as neutral sounding as possible.

    History

    The Prixic System was created by Tumblr user kenochoric on December 6th, 2020[1]. Proposed flags for the terms were later posted on December 8th, 2020[2]. On January 23rd, 2021, a section of the creators Carrd was dedicated to the Prixic System, and it's stated that it will continue to be added onto in the future.[3]
